Yu Yu Hakusho

description Yu Yu Hakusho Overview

A supernatural action manga by Yoshihiro Togashi serialized in Weekly Shonen Jump from 1990 to 1994, following a teenage delinquent turned spirit detective.

help Yu Yu Hakusho FAQ

Who created the manga Yu Yu Hakusho?

The series was created, written, and illustrated by Japanese manga artist Yoshihiro Togashi. It was serialized weekly in Shueisha's 'Weekly Shonen Jump' magazine from 1990 to 1994.

What is the premise of Yu Yu Hakusho?

The story begins with Yusuke Urameshi, a teenage delinquent who unexpectedly dies saving a child from a car accident. Because his death was unforeseen by the afterlife, he is given a chance to be revived by acting as a 'Spirit Detective' investigating supernatural threats in the human world.

How many volumes of the Yu Yu Hakusho manga are there?

The original manga run spans a total of 19 collected tankobon volumes. It was later adapted into a highly successful 112-episode anime television series by Studio Pierrot in 1992.

Did Yu Yu Hakusho win any major manga awards?

Yes, the series won the prestigious Shogakukan Manga Award for the 'Shonen' (boys) category in 1993. This cemented its status alongside other legendary Shonen Jump titles of that era, like 'Dragon Ball' and 'Slam Dunk.'
